Pete Crow-Armstrong powers Cubs to victory over Red Sox
by Chris Schommer | Cubs Correspondent | Sun, Jul 20th 8:45am EDT
Pete Crow-Armstrong went 2-for-4 in the win against the Red Sox with a home run, one RBI, one run scored, and one stolen base.
Fantasy Impact:
The outfielder continues a solid stretch at the plate, hitting .279 with five home runs and 10 RBI over his last 15 games for the Cubs. After yesterday’s game, Crow-Armstrong is hitting .268 with 26 home runs, 72 RBI, and 28 stolen bases over 97 games this season.
